I wanted to write a sea shanty with a heroine and this is what came out. Of course sea shanties by their very nature are very male songs, created and sung by men at sea. A story of a woman at sea may seem romantic, but it is also reflective of the huge number of women who lived and worked out their lives as men. Much of the physical work was available only to men, who were paid higher wages and allowed more freedom than working class women.
